SYRIA, Seleucis and Pieria. Laodicea ad Mare. Septimius Severus, 193-211. Tetradrachm (Silver, 27 mm, 15.35 g, 12 h), 207-208. AYT KAI - CEOYHPOC - CE Laureate and draped bust of Septimius Severus to right. Rev. ΔHMAPX EΞ VPATOC TO Γ Eagle standing facing with spread wings, turning his head to left with a wreath in beak; between eagle's legs, star. McAlee, Severan Group 2, 16. Prieur 1140. Well-struck and nicely toned. Extremely fine.
From a European collection, acquired privately from Elsen in Brussels in 1988.
The portrait of Septimius Severus on this coin is both elegant and a rather lively. He seems to have sparkling eyes and a pleasant expression, albeit one that could become extremely angry and dangerous if provoked.
